Neil Armstrong Purdue Statue Gallery 2022 Neil Armstrong Purdue Statue Gallery 2022

Neil Armstrong Purdue Statue

Nov. 23, 2024

Neil Armstrong sculpture, lunar footprints, unveiled at Purdue Neil Armstrong Statue Purdue University Photograph by Steve Gass - Fine Art America Neil Armstrong statue | Purdue university, Purdue, Neil armstrong Neil Armstrong statue at Purdue University Photograph by Eldon McGraw - Pixels Neil Armstrong Statue out side of the Neil Armstrong building - Picture of Purdue University, West Lafayette - Tripadvisor A statue of Apollo 11 astronaut Neil Armstrong stands outside the Neil Armstrong Hall of Engineering at the Purdue University campus in West Lafayette Stock Photo - Alamy | Neil Armstrong Purdue Statue


Link 1 | Link 2 | Link 3 | Link 4 | Link 5 | Link 6 |